Kuala Lumpur vs Korf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ia and Korf, Russia is approximately 8,330 km or 5,176 mi.
  • To reach Kuala Lumpur in this distance one would set out from Korf bearing 248.9°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kuala Lumpur bearing 207.5° or SSW .
  • Kuala Lumpur has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Korf has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
  • Kuala Lumpur is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Korf is in or near the subpolar wet tundra bi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 29.1 °C (52.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 24.6 °C (44.3°F) less in Kuala Lumpur.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1922.9 mm (75.7 in) more which is equivalent to 1922.9 l/m² (47.19 US gal/ft²) or 19,229,000 l/ha (2,055,708 US gal/ac) more. About 5 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 44.9° higher in Kuala Lumpur than in Korf.
